While the perceptions and myths preceding(prenominal) about pit bulls may count to be valid, facts and scientific evidence try otherwise.According to a study conducted by the American Veterinary Medicine Association, there is no evidence showing that pit bulls are disproportionately dangerous (Holland). It has also been established that this breed of dog does not have locking jaws they do not have special enzymes or mechanism al lowing them to lock jaws.A comparison of their skulls to that of other breeds of dogs shows that they share general bone bodily structure and have similar characteristics. It is their determination that when savage down on something and not easily releasing makes them appear like they have locking jaws (Coile). The misconception that pit bulls are inherently vicious can also be refuted using facts. It should first be noted that this myth is a stereotype that is solely aimed at the entire breed (Landau).When evaluated on own merit rather than the breed, one can easily find out that a pit bull is really a good dog that is inherently friendly to military personnel and other dogs. The parameter that pit bulls are aggressive towards humanness and other dogs is unfounded (Marrs). Perhaps the sort pit bulls are raised or trained make them an aggressive breed.The myths and misconceptions associated with pit bulls have created an impression that their adoption is dangerous, especial ly if they have unknown parentage and history.This myth is inappropriate because it fails to acknowledge that, just like humans, each dog ought to be judged by their own behavior and personality (Marrs). It also fails to recognize that pit bulls that are portraying negative behaviors and personalities are not doing so because of their nature but because of other factors.These factors accommodate having been horribly neglected and abused in the past or having been forced to fight (Landau). Pit bulls that have been rescued and raised victorianly tend to show proper temperament and behavior towards human beings. This interpretation helps to address the other false portrayal about pit bulls that adopting a pit bull pup is better than an adult one.Regardless of whether someone adopts a puppy or an adult one, the most all important(predicate) thing is how one treats a pit bull. One should nurture it in such(prenominal) a manner that enables it to develop desired and positive traits ( Dickey).
